Awesome #'s. With a raised limiter you probably won't see any more power on the dyno, however it will enable you to put your car directly in the power band on shifts and run better track results. I have seen that the Hotcam is best shifted at ~6400 or so. Again, those are some BAD *** #'s. A lot of the newer "magical" cams are making about that much on stock headed cars...

Well i had the hot cam
I dynoed 389hp and 384 tq with it.
I now have the T1 cam and dynoed
391hp and 389 tq.
But there is a big difference at the track.
Hot cam 114 traps
T1 118 traps
